The Healthy Planet is 11 Earth Days Old!
Earth Day is April 22 and the St. Louis Earth Day Festival
will be held April 20 on the grounds of the Muny in Forest
Park. We encourage all 90,000 Healthy Planet magazine readers
to attend. The way things have been going GREEN lately, I
suspect Earth Day will enjoy a record crowd.
It was 11 Earth Days ago that The Healthy Planet magazine
first appeared in St. Louis. The festival was held in Tower
Grove Park back then. A 45-year-old publishing journeyman
stood behind a table stacked with fledgling issues of St.
Louis’ first Natural Living magazine. Knowing virtually
no one except the gracious Earth Day Festival directors, the
bearded man hawked his publication to a friendly crowd. Those
were the days of great anxiety, debt, doubt and yet idealistic
hope. How could conservative St. Louis embrace such a radical
magazine. Filled with articles about acupuncture, recycled
plastic decking, therapeutic massage, aromatherapy, healthy
foods, solar and wind power, and alternative healing ... how
would people take these types of “alternative”
topics? Well, 11 years later I think we know the answer to
that question. All those “alternative” topics
we covered in the very first issue of The Healthy Planet are
today part of the growing mainstream consciousness. Do we
still have a long way to go? Of course, but we have at least
climbed a big hill and can see the horizon. Our first issue
was 16 pages back in 1997. This current issue of The Healthy
Planet is 52 pages. We have grown in readership, stewardship
and responsibility. As St. Louis’ voice for Natural
Living and Environmental News, we invite everyone to join
us in our ongoing quest to help St. Louisans become more earth-friendly,
healthier and more socially responsible. Over the years we
have provided health, wellness and environmental articles
and resources in order to provide a balanced approach to creating
a healthier lifestyle. Other cities have spiritual newspapers,
and now some green magazines, but few offer the unique holistic
approach The Healthy Planet provides by completing the circle
of healthy living and a healthy planet. Our magazine has grown
because of our committed staff, our unique writers, our loyal
advertisers and our ever increasing readers over the past
11 years. There is a movement going on. A bit more subtle
